International Channel Manager

Job at University of Kent in Canterbury, Kent, CT2

## Review of the International Channel Manager Opportunity This review provides an overview of the International Channel Manager role, highlighting key advantages and considerations for prospective candidates to aid in their career path decisions.

This position offers a significant opportunity for a driven professional to play a pivotal role in achieving the University of Kent's strategic international student recruitment targets. The International Channel Manager will be instrumental in cultivating and managing key relationships with agent representative partners and pathway/progression partners, a critical component of the university's global outreach. The role demands a proactive and creative approach to navigating a complex and competitive international higher education landscape, making it an ideal platform for individuals seeking to make a tangible impact.
